I had the Beaglebone running fine for two and a half years.
Then while issuing apt-get update, the file system turned read-only, and 
the update failed to end well.

-- Analyze --
I issued journalctl -r and noticed the emmc had errors in the device layer, 
which caused the file system to turn read-only.

-- Solution --
So I powered off the beaglebone.
I dis-assembled it from its cape.
I connected a FTDI serial cable to it and a USB cable.

When it booted I saw:

To fix I ran:


(initramfs) fsck /dev/mmcblk1p1 

fsck from util-linux 2.25.2 
e2fsck 1.42.12 (29-Aug-2014) 
BEAGLEBONE contains a file system with errors, check forced. 
Pass 1: Checking inodes, blocks, and sizes 
Inodes that were part of a corrupted orphan linked list found. Fix<y>? yes 
Inode 1546 was part of the orphaned inode list. FIXED. 
Inode 1987 was part of the orphaned inode list. FIXED. 
Inode 2030 was part of the orphaned inode list. FIXED. 
Inode 2368 was part of the orphaned inode list. FIXED. 
Inode 3705 was part of the orphaned inode list. FIXED. 
Inode 4250 was part of the orphaned inode list. FIXED. 
Inode 4631 was part of the orphaned inode list. FIXED. 
Inode 5592 was part of the orphaned inode list. FIXED. 
Inode 5700 was part of the orphaned inode list. FIXED. 
Deleted inode 5798 has zero dtime. Fix<y>? yes 
Inode 6022 was part of the orphaned inode list. FIXED. 
Inode 32774 was part of the orphaned inode list. FIXED. 
Inode 69992 was part of the orphaned inode list. FIXED. 
Pass 2: Checking directory structure 
Pass 3: Checking directory connectivity 
Pass 4: Checking reference counts 
Pass 5: Checking group summary information 
Block bitmap differences: -17865 -(51892--51894) -258249 -(258252--258254) 
-(268977--269121) -(404932--404971) -(626553--626600) -(659072--659186) 
-(766034--766160) 
Fix<y>? yes
BEAGLEBONE: ***** FILE SYSTEM WAS MODIFIED ***** 
BEAGLEBONE: 132374/236176 files (0.1% non-contiguous), 548166/943872 blocks 
(initramfs) fsck /dev/mmcblk1p1 
fsck from util-linux 2.25.2 
e2fsck 1.42.12 (29-Aug-2014) 
BEAGLEBONE: clean, 132374/236176 files, 548166/943872 blocks


Then  type exit and <enter>
and the device booted as before.
